Skip to content

Commit 73d21df

Browse files
committed
Removing an inappropriate class used to wrap inline radio form controls.
And switch inline margin from left to right side to allow for alignment left. Fixes #1240 Fixes #1234
1 parent 3f779bc commit 73d21df

File tree

5 files changed

+43
-43
lines changed

5 files changed

+43
-43
lines changed

app/styles/_forms.less

+9
Original file line numberDiff line numberDiff line change
@@ -86,3 +86,12 @@
8686
// the sections just above.
8787
margin-top: @line-height-computed;
8888
}
89+
90+
// Switch default bootstrap margin from left to the right side to enable left alignment of inputs at mobile
91+
.radio-inline,
92+
.radio-inline + .radio-inline,
93+
.checkbox-inline,
94+
.checkbox-inline + .checkbox-inline {
95+
margin-left: 0;
96+
margin-right: 10px;
97+
}

app/views/directives/edit-lifecycle-hook.html

+18-18
Original file line numberDiff line numberDiff line change
@@ -10,24 +10,24 @@
1010

1111
<div class="form-group">
1212
<label for="actionType" class="required">Lifecycle Action</label><br/>
13-
<div class="radio">
14-
<label class="radio-inline">
15-
<input type="radio"
16-
name="{{type}}-action-newpod"
17-
ng-model="action.type"
18-
value="execNewPod"
19-
aria-describedby="action-help">
20-
Run a specific command in a new pod
21-
</label>
22-
<label class="radio-inline">
23-
<input type="radio"
24-
name="{{type}}-action-images"
25-
ng-model="action.type"
26-
value="tagImages"
27-
aria-describedby="action-help">
28-
Tag image if the deployment succeeds
29-
</label>
30-
</div>
13+
<label class="radio-inline">
14+
<input
15+
type="radio"
16+
name="{{type}}-action-newpod"
17+
ng-model="action.type"
18+
value="execNewPod"
19+
aria-describedby="action-help">
20+
Run a specific command in a new pod
21+
</label>
22+
<label class="radio-inline">
23+
<input
24+
type="radio"
25+
name="{{type}}-action-images"
26+
ng-model="action.type"
27+
value="tagImages"
28+
aria-describedby="action-help">
29+
Tag image if the deployment succeeds
30+
</label>
3131
<div id="action-help" class="help-block">
3232
<span ng-if="action.type === 'execNewPod'">Runs a command in a new pod using the container from the deployment template. You can add additional environment variables and volumes.</span>
3333
<span ng-if="action.type === 'tagImages'">Tags the current image as an image stream tag if the deployment succeeds.</span>

app/views/directives/osc-persistent-volume-claim.html

+13-19
Original file line numberDiff line numberDiff line change
@@ -89,25 +89,19 @@
8989
</div>
9090

9191
<div class="form-group" >
92-
<label class="required">Access Mode</label>
93-
<div class="radio">
94-
95-
<label class="radio-inline">
96-
<input type="radio" name="accessModes" ng-model="claim.accessModes" value="ReadWriteOnce" aria-describedby="access-modes-help" ng-checked="true" >
97-
Single User (RWO)
98-
</label>
99-
100-
<label class="radio-inline">
101-
<input type="radio" id="accessModes" name="accessModes" ng-model="claim.accessModes" value="ReadWriteMany" aria-describedby="access-modes-help" >
102-
Shared Access (RWX)
103-
</label>
104-
105-
<label class="radio-inline">
106-
<input type="radio" name="accessModes" ng-model="claim.accessModes" value="ReadOnlyMany" aria-describedby="access-modes-help">
107-
Read Only (ROX)
108-
</label>
109-
110-
</div>
92+
<label class="required">Access Mode</label><br/>
93+
<label class="radio-inline">
94+
<input type="radio" name="accessModes" ng-model="claim.accessModes" value="ReadWriteOnce" aria-describedby="access-modes-help" ng-checked="true" >
95+
Single User (RWO)
96+
</label>
97+
<label class="radio-inline">
98+
<input type="radio" id="accessModes" name="accessModes" ng-model="claim.accessModes" value="ReadWriteMany" aria-describedby="access-modes-help" >
99+
Shared Access (RWX)
100+
</label>
101+
<label class="radio-inline">
102+
<input type="radio" name="accessModes" ng-model="claim.accessModes" value="ReadOnlyMany" aria-describedby="access-modes-help">
103+
Read Only (ROX)
104+
</label>
111105
<div>
112106
<span id="access-modes-help" class="help-block">Permissions to the mounted volume.</span>
113107
</div>

dist/scripts/templates.js

+1-5
Original file line numberDiff line numberDiff line change
@@ -6858,7 +6858,6 @@ angular.module('openshiftConsoleTemplates', []).run(['$templateCache', function(
68586858
"<fieldset ng-disabled=\"view.isDisabled\">\n" +
68596859
"<div class=\"form-group\">\n" +
68606860
"<label for=\"actionType\" class=\"required\">Lifecycle Action</label><br/>\n" +
6861-
"<div class=\"radio\">\n" +
68626861
"<label class=\"radio-inline\">\n" +
68636862
"<input type=\"radio\" name=\"{{type}}-action-newpod\" ng-model=\"action.type\" value=\"execNewPod\" aria-describedby=\"action-help\">\n" +
68646863
"Run a specific command in a new pod\n" +
@@ -6867,7 +6866,6 @@ angular.module('openshiftConsoleTemplates', []).run(['$templateCache', function(
68676866
"<input type=\"radio\" name=\"{{type}}-action-images\" ng-model=\"action.type\" value=\"tagImages\" aria-describedby=\"action-help\">\n" +
68686867
"Tag image if the deployment succeeds\n" +
68696868
"</label>\n" +
6870-
"</div>\n" +
68716869
"<div id=\"action-help\" class=\"help-block\">\n" +
68726870
"<span ng-if=\"action.type === 'execNewPod'\">Runs a command in a new pod using the container from the deployment template. You can add additional environment variables and volumes.</span>\n" +
68736871
"<span ng-if=\"action.type === 'tagImages'\">Tags the current image as an image stream tag if the deployment succeeds.</span>\n" +
@@ -7995,8 +7993,7 @@ angular.module('openshiftConsoleTemplates', []).run(['$templateCache', function(
79957993
"</div>\n" +
79967994
"</div>\n" +
79977995
"<div class=\"form-group\">\n" +
7998-
"<label class=\"required\">Access Mode</label>\n" +
7999-
"<div class=\"radio\">\n" +
7996+
"<label class=\"required\">Access Mode</label><br/>\n" +
80007997
"<label class=\"radio-inline\">\n" +
80017998
"<input type=\"radio\" name=\"accessModes\" ng-model=\"claim.accessModes\" value=\"ReadWriteOnce\" aria-describedby=\"access-modes-help\" ng-checked=\"true\">\n" +
80027999
"Single User (RWO)\n" +
@@ -8009,7 +8006,6 @@ angular.module('openshiftConsoleTemplates', []).run(['$templateCache', function(
80098006
"<input type=\"radio\" name=\"accessModes\" ng-model=\"claim.accessModes\" value=\"ReadOnlyMany\" aria-describedby=\"access-modes-help\">\n" +
80108007
"Read Only (ROX)\n" +
80118008
"</label>\n" +
8012-
"</div>\n" +
80138009
"<div>\n" +
80148010
"<span id=\"access-modes-help\" class=\"help-block\">Permissions to the mounted volume.</span>\n" +
80158011
"</div>\n" +

dist/styles/main.css

+2-1
Original file line numberDiff line numberDiff line change
@@ -705,7 +705,7 @@ textarea.form-control{height:auto}
705705
.checkbox input[type=checkbox],.checkbox-inline input[type=checkbox],.radio input[type=radio],.radio-inline input[type=radio]{position:absolute;margin-left:-20px;margin-top:4px\9}
706706
.checkbox+.checkbox,.radio+.radio{margin-top:-5px}
707707
.checkbox-inline,.radio-inline{position:relative;display:inline-block;padding-left:20px;margin-bottom:0;vertical-align:middle;font-weight:400;cursor:pointer}
708-
.checkbox-inline+.checkbox-inline,.radio-inline+.radio-inline{margin-top:0;margin-left:10px}
708+
.checkbox-inline+.checkbox-inline,.radio-inline+.radio-inline{margin-top:0}
709709
.checkbox-inline.disabled,.checkbox.disabled label,.radio-inline.disabled,.radio.disabled label,fieldset[disabled] .checkbox label,fieldset[disabled] .checkbox-inline,fieldset[disabled] .radio label,fieldset[disabled] .radio-inline,fieldset[disabled] input[type=checkbox],fieldset[disabled] input[type=radio],input[type=checkbox].disabled,input[type=checkbox][disabled],input[type=radio].disabled,input[type=radio][disabled]{cursor:not-allowed}
710710
.form-control-static{padding-top:3px;padding-bottom:3px;margin-bottom:0;min-height:34px}
711711
.form-control-static.input-lg,.form-control-static.input-sm{padding-left:0;padding-right:0}
@@ -3600,6 +3600,7 @@ to{transform:rotate(359deg)}
36003600
}
36013601
.osc-file-input textarea{font-family:Menlo,Monaco,Consolas,monospace;margin:5px 0}
36023602
.health-checks-form .pause-rollouts-checkbox,.set-limits-form .pause-rollouts-checkbox{margin-top:21px}
3603+
.checkbox-inline,.checkbox-inline+.checkbox-inline,.radio-inline,.radio-inline+.radio-inline{margin-left:0;margin-right:10px}
36033604
.card-pf{box-shadow:0 3px 1px -2px rgba(0,0,0,.15),0 2px 2px 0 rgba(0,0,0,.1),0 1px 5px 0 rgba(0,0,0,.09)}
36043605
.card-pf .image-icon,.card-pf .template-icon{font-size:28px;line-height:1;margin-right:15px;opacity:.38}
36053606
.card-pf-badge{color:#999;font-size:11px;text-transform:uppercase}

0 commit comments

Comments
 (0)